WebA Notary Public must file an oath of office and bond with the Office of the County Clerk in the county where their principal place of business is located. WebTo file a county change, you must request an oath of office form from the Secretary of State. The oath will have the name of your original county, however, you will take and … WebPursuant to Government Code Section 8213 (a), all notary public applicants must file the oath of office and bond with the County Clerk in the county which the applicant maintains their principal place of business. This must be completed no later than 30 days after the beginning term prescribed in the commission.
